Project name:  “Service Cloud A”
 

Project description

Design & global rollout of a “CX service Cloud” solution for Pre-sales and Post-sales teams for one business unit 

 

Background to the assignment

The Service Cloud Project is one crucial driver for an amazing customer experience. The Customer Service central point of contact, offering state of the art Customer interaction functionality that grows with Henkel Adhesives, providing key actionable information drawn from the Adhesive Technologies application landscape, to support serving Customers globally, acknowledging their unique sales engagement plans and service agreements. The project is running in an agile mode, planned to start end 2021 with a 6 month MVP and a global rollout for the relevant pre-sales and post-sales teams within Adhesive technologies. It is about implementation of a service cloud application, together with a CTI-solution (computer telephony integration).

Concrete, detailed description of services

The services shall be provided within the framework of an agile development method. The concrete activities required in each case to implement the services commissioned shall be agreed iteratively between the parties within the framework of sprint meetings and implemented by the Contractor within the respective sprints following the sprint meetings. Prior to each sprint meeting, the contractor shall independently check, on the basis of its professional expertise, which individual services are reasonable and feasible within the scope of the assignment in the respective sprint. The sprints each have a duration of 2 weeks, so that the sprint meetings take place at intervals of 2 weeks. Within the individual sprints, the contracting parties shall coordinate the respective technical requirements for the services to be provided in weekly meetings in order to achieve the compatibility of the individual components of the software Service Cloud/Genesys. The technical requirements for the services to be provided are assessed by the Contractor on the basis of its own technical assessment. After completion of a Sprint, the Parties shall conduct a "Sprint Review'' in which the Contractor reports on the feasibility and status of the services performed by it in the previous Sprint and makes a recommendation on how to proceed with regard to the services that proved to be unfeasible in the respective Sprint. All of the meetings and exchanges described above shall take place exclusively in the presence of a central contact person named by us, who shall coordinate the project on our internal side. The organisation and scheduling of the meetings described above in which the Contractor is involved shall be organised and carried out by the Contractor and coordinated with us. 

Project is split into a MVP phase and later Rollout phases. During both phases the dedicated activities for the external resources are planned as such:

- Build up a test plan and test coordination concept. 
- establish and affiliate proper documentation standards (as agreed in the project and based on PMI standards) and project structure in the project sharepoint. Concretely it means that sharepoint structure needs to be tracked and defined documents need to be cross-read to achieve compliance with the project standards. If not meeting the standards, the author of the respective document needs to be contacted for rework or the project manager himself needs to rework
- Coordinate the cross-subteam meetings including documentation and tracking of open points. Concretely it means that meeting invites need to be sent to the expected participants, minutes need to be taken and open points need to be entered & tracked in the open topic tracker list in the sharepoint. In the jour fixe meetings the owners of open & due points need to be asked for action.
- coordinate compilation of the steering committee slides with the other project managers and the subteams. Concretely it means that the contractor should proactively drive compilation of the steering committee slides by contacting the other project managers and subteam-leads, collect the information and run the final layout & content review. Final review by program manager (not project manager) to be actively conducted by the contractor.
- track scope changes and evaluate its impact on the project, based on feedback from the relevant subteams (timeline, budget, resources). The contractor is asked to host & facilitate the discussion (“in-scope or not”, decision making process “yes/no/later”) within the project manager team. Evaluation needs to be shared with the other project managers and responsible program managers (in case of escalation). 
- conceptually work out the exit / closing criteria for the MVP and each rollout. The draft concept is to be aligned with the other project managers

All concepts & work is planned to get conceptually build up by the external resource, but finally approved by the Henkel project accountable.
